WebDec 7, 2024 · 1. Bruxism. Bruxism is one of the most well-known causes of tongue biting. This condition causes you to grind your teeth and can also be accompanied by biting your tongue or the inside of your cheek. That can happen to you both while awake and during sleep, when you are less likely to control your jaw. Cheek Biting: What You Need To Know - Colgate

Often, compulsive cheek biters experience feelings of guilt and shame about their self-injurious BFRB. This can lead to a feeling of hopelessness. Sometimes, they will go to great measures to stop other people seeing the behavior, which could limit their social activity and interaction. Biting the inside of the cheek repetitively is a bad habit which can cause the skin of your inner cheek to thicken, scar, and …

WebAug 13, 2024 · Seek dental consult: Cheek biting could indicate a lack of a stable, repeatable chewing motion, which often can be related to bite problems including crossbites and premature tooth interferences. Repeated traumatic injuries to the lining of the cheek can lead to more serious problems. It is prudent to consult a dentist for an evaluation. WebBusiness, Economics, and Finance. WebDec 8, 2024 · How to Help Heal a Bite on the Inside of Your Mouth. 1 1. Clean the bite. 2 2. Press with cloth or gauze to stop the bleeding. 3 3. Apply something cold to reduce swelling. 4 4. Take a pain reliever like ibuprofen. 5 5. Rinse with warm salt water.

WebDec 30, 2024 · Rinse with warm salt water a couple of times a day, particularly after meals. Use a solution of one part water to one part hydrogen peroxide, rinse and spit out.
